WitrynaTo ensure your safety, measure the tread depth as part of your regular vehicle maintenance. Tread is the rubber on the tire that touches the road. New tires have an average tread depth of 8 to 9 millimeters (10/32 to 11/32 inches). As you drive, the tread will wear down. A tire with a tread depth below 1.6 millimeters (2/32 inches) lacks grip. easy homemade fajita seasoning recipeWitryna05. Feb, 2024.
